Archiconcepts, a bureau for architectural design and visualization, is
located in Gemert, Noord Brabant - The Netherlands. Our commissions are
based on assignment from entrepreneurs, project developers and end
users. The essence of our design is based on the client’s views and
requirements – and those of the actual users of the building. |
    
Core Activities..
|
The office has been established on designing various types of projects that
vary from public buildings such as schools and offices, private housing,
housing extensions, interior design projects, 3D modeling, rendering and
visualizations. |
Philosophy,
Design Approach and Style..
|
Beauty is
harmony of all the parts within a body, so that nothing may be added,
taken away or altered, but for worse. In our practice we do not follow a
certain style. We believe that each commission is interpreted freely,
each project has its own individual personality that stems from the
special characteristic of its needs and governed by the surrounding
environment and its unique location. The result should be harmoniously
integrated with its atmosphere till the smallest details.*
*Refer to the Gemerts Nieuwsblad article dated
March 12th 2002 about the
integration of the Pandelaar school project, commissioned by Gemente
Gemert-Bakel, with its surrounding environment". |

Working
with Other Disciplines..
|
In Archiconcepts we commit ourselves to the design process and solving
all architectural challenges. Regarding other disciplines involvement
(HVAC, electrical, civil and structural, calculations and site
management) we work together with other consultants that can be selected
from our associates or designated by the client. |

Fees..
|
We apply the Dutch Standard Terms and Conditions Governing the Legal
Relationship between Client and Architect 1997 (SR-97) for both the
administrative provisions and the basis for calculating our fees.
Although our services vary in the amount of work involved from one
project to the other, we therefore establish clearly, together with the
client, what is expected from us and what is not. This will be the basis
of our fees. |
